Power 4 Conference Baseball Tournaments Wrap With Kansas, Georgia Tech, UCLA, Georgia Champions

Four Power 4 conference tournaments concluded over the weekend, setting the stage for Monday's NCAA tournament selection show. Kansas captured the Big 12 title with a 9-0 victory over West Virginia, marking their first conference tournament championship in two decades. The Jayhawks joined three other regular-season champions in sweeping their respective conference tournaments.

Georgia Tech dominated North Carolina 13-6 to claim the ACC crown, while UCLA outlasted Oregon 3-2 in 11 innings for the Big Ten championship. The Bruins survived a double-elimination format that switched to single-elimination in the quarterfinals. Across all tournaments, top seeds largely prevailed with several dramatic finishes.

In the SEC, Georgia routed Arkansas 11-1 in seven innings to complete their tournament run. The Bulldogs, Yellow Jackets, Bruins, and Jayhawks all secured automatic bids to the NCAA tournament as conference champions. These results provide the final piece of evaluation for the selection committee before Monday's bracket reveal.
